Subject[PATCH 5.10 407/545] s390/zcore: fix race when reading from hardware system area
Date
From: Alexander Gordeev <agordeev@linux.ibm.com>

[ Upstream commit 9ffed254d938c9e99eb7761c7f739294c84e0367 ]

Memory buffer used for reading out data from hardware system
area is not protected against concurrent access.

---
drivers/s390/char/zcore.c | 11 ++++++++++-
1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/s390/char/zcore.c b/drivers/s390/char/zcore.c
index 1515fdc3c1ab..3841c0e77df6 100644
--- a/drivers/s390/char/zcore.c
+++ b/drivers/s390/char/zcore.c
@@ -48,6 +48,7 @@ static struct dentry *zcore_reipl_file;
static struct dentry *zcore_hsa_file;
static struct ipl_parameter_block *zcore_ipl_block;

+static DEFINE_MUTEX(hsa_buf_mutex);
static char hsa_buf[PAGE_SIZE] __aligned(PAGE_SIZE);

/*
@@ -64,19 +65,24 @@ int memcpy_hsa_user(void __user *dest, unsigned long src, size_t count)
if (!hsa_available)
return -ENODATA;

+ mutex_lock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
while (count) {
if (sclp_sdias_copy(hsa_buf, src / PAGE_SIZE + 2, 1)) {
TRACE("sclp_sdias_copy() failed\n");
+ mutex_unlock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
return -EIO;
}
offset = src % PAGE_SIZE;
bytes = min(PAGE_SIZE - offset, count);
- if (copy_to_user(dest, hsa_buf + offset, bytes))
+ if (copy_to_user(dest, hsa_buf + offset, bytes)) {
+ mutex_unlock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
return -EFAULT;
+ }
src += bytes;
dest += bytes;
count -= bytes;
}
+ mutex_unlock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
return 0;
}

@@ -94,9 +100,11 @@ int memcpy_hsa_kernel(void *dest, unsigned long src, size_t count)
if (!hsa_available)
return -ENODATA;

+ mutex_lock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
while (count) {
if (sclp_sdias_copy(hsa_buf, src / PAGE_SIZE + 2, 1)) {
TRACE("sclp_sdias_copy() failed\n");
+ mutex_unlock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
return -EIO;
}
offset = src % PAGE_SIZE;
@@ -106,6 +114,7 @@ int memcpy_hsa_kernel(void *dest, unsigned long src, size_t count)
dest += bytes;
count -= bytes;
}
+ mutex_unlock(&hsa_buf_mutex);
return 0;
}
